  • Publication number: 20190179597
    Abstract: Systems and techniques are provided for audio synchronization and delay estimation. Audio metadata including a first discrete Fourier transform representation may be received. An audio signal may be pre-processed. A second discrete Fourier transform representation may be generated from the pre-processed audio signal. A correlation result in a discrete Fourier transform representation may be generated based on an element-wise multiplication of the first and second discrete Fourier transform representations. An inverse Fourier transform may be performed on the correlation result in a discrete Fourier transform representation to generate a correlated signal including samples that may have a position and a value. A relative delay value may be determined based on the position of a sample having a value with the greatest magnitude. Playback of a second audio signal may be adjusted based on a current delay value adjusted based on the relative delay value.
